Birdlife near Margaret River @ Yelverton Brook

Splendid Blue Wren

Hi from sunny Margaret River the birdlife is in full swing with all parent being very busy feeding their young offspring.

I have even seen the beautiful Splendid Blue Wren’s with some of their young just as you see on the postcards!

What treat.

The Yellow Robins are getting very friendly and love feeding on bugs around the spa chalets, a very eco friendly pest control method.

The 28 Parrots or know as Port Lincoln’s are funny as they love to boss each other around whilst the quite ones sneak in a get a feed. The only difference between the male and female is the bright red ridge just above the males beak. In this species the female is as pretty as the male for a change.

Over 50+ species of birds have currently been recorded at Yelverton Brook Eco Spa Retreat & Conservation Sanctuary, in each chalet is a Bird field guide book to help you identify the birds and hopefully record any new species.

Come and stay with us and help find & record some new species to the list. There is a list of recorded birds on our website at Yelverton Brook Birdlist

It is a really good birdwatching area with the Wonnerup Wetlands nearby which are Ramsar Listed and offer world class birdwatching here in Western Australia.

Woylies love fungi at Yelverton Brook near Margaret River

Filed under: australia — jensor @ 6:19 am

Well the evidence is clear to see, the Woylie’s favourite food is Truffles and fungi like mushrooms and toadstools are pretty close.

On walking around the 100 ac sanctuary yesterday morning with the wet, damp weather the fungi is loving this type of weather. The Woylies seem to nibble some tops, the bottom of some stalks pulling them out of the ground and laying them on their sides. Some look they must taste really good as they are heavily eaten.

Most of the fungi seen so far is closer to the creek line area, offering a damper environment. With many colours of the rainbow with pale frilly white, soft fawns, yellows, curry yellows to large puff balls…..a fantastic variety on offer for a hungry critter!

Check out our Photo Gallery on Fungi found at Yelverton Brook Eco Spa Retreat.

Joy learnt about these fascinating plants whilst learning to be a Kings Park Guide many years ago. They had a great speaker who shared his passion about these unique flora.

Land for wildlife at Yelverton Brook

Stakeholder and community involvement and education –

All chalets have “Wildlife Journals” for clients to record fauna sightings which offer an invaluable insight into movements of fauna around the chalets and walk trails. They offer great input from their clients into their conservation work.

Also clients are encouraged to email fauna pictures to be placed in the website in a special “Guests Photo Gallery”.

Yelverton Brook is offering the area to school & tertiary students for research projects with this unique site secure from predators. Studies into our diverse frog population are also on the agenda & need cataloguing. They are registered with Frogs Australia and listed on their website. They have been working closely with Earth Sanctuaries in SA. They offered an educational visit to the Ecotourism students from Edith Cowan Bunbury campus twice for a real working site for inspection. Joy Ensor lectured on Ecotourism for students studying at Edith Cowan University in Joondalup Campus in Perth in Aug ’05.

Land for wildlifeThey are also members of “Land for Wildlife” run by DEC.

Conservation Week WA 2005 was supported by Yelverton Brook and made aware their local tourist bureaus of this event.

Offering a safe release site for orphaned and injured native fauna. Stage 2 with the Eco Centre, conference centre/educational facilities, café/kiosk, bbq area with picnic setting, chapel & small conference centre will allow more community interaction & offer a wide range of activities.

Quote – 2002- 2006 – The Busselton Agricultural Show – On behalf of the President and committee of this society I thank you sincerely for your sponsorship of a trophy for the “Fauna Carers Award” in the Busselton Show.

Cultural considerationsis offering the property to the local indigenous aboriginal people to run bush tucker tours through the property, plus building a close working relationship with the local Warden Centre.

The Ensor’s are committed Christians and believe in helping their local community, they are only caretakers of this precious land.

Flutes Restaurant near Margaret River by Yelverton Brook

Filed under: margaret river, restaurant, wedding, weddings, western australia — jensor @ 3:07 pm
Tags:

A short time ago we took mother out for a drive to their old farm in Willyabrup which now is the home of Flutes Restaurant and Brookland Valley Vineyard.

The cafe/restaurant is situated over looking the Willyabrup River and a large dam come lake on it. Have a look at the pics below.

Offering beautiful gardens, great food, notice the Peter Pan in the family picture on the right hand side. A popular place for special events, birthdays and weddings.

When the Ensor’s owned it was a 1,000 ac farm stretching from Caves Road to the coast. A most beautiful place with an 80′ gorge country section along the river cutting through granite. They put the local Marron into the lake which grow to a fair size in this large body of water.

Even a great quick stop for a wine tasting or afternoon tea, the Devonshire tea is great.

Imagine the Ensor kids swimming in the dam, surfing the dam using the old beetle (car) with a very long rope………or being towed around by their farm dog who enjoyed a swim in the dam.

Definitely worth a visit whilst staying at Yelverton Brook Eco Spa Retreat & Conservation Sanctuary near Margaret River in Western Australia. A most beautiful region for fine wine and dining options.
